  • QuickTime Slide Shows in iPhoto

    Is it possible to edit a QuickTime Slide Show (often called a QuickTime movie), i.e. is it possible to change the music in a completed QuickTime Slide Show. Let's say that I make a slide show in iPhoto and I add the music, and I file it in a folder. Can I take that slide show and later change the music in that slide show, ie exchange the selected song with another song. Or do I have to remake the slide show in order to add the other music?

    Depending on the type of slide show you've made (iPhoto makes two styles) you can edit the final .mov file using QuickTime Pro.
    One of the iPhoto types uses three nearly identical video tracks slightly offset in time and another track that provides the "fade" effect. The other type is a 30 fps (frames per second) video that contains transitions and effects and all is contained in one video track.
    Lets assume that your music track is three minutes in either type. Adding a 4 minute new audio track will slow down the playback and alter the frame rate. Not a big deal for a simple fade slide show but it will reduce the frame rate when added scaled.
    Open your new sound file using QT Pro, select all (Command-A) and copy (Command-C).
    Switch to your slide show movie, select all and "Add to Selection & Scale" from the Edit menu.
    Open the Movie Properties window. Highlight your original sound track and "Delete".
    Use Save As, name the file and pick a location to save. This will leave your original file intact.
    Same images and effects as the original with a new audio track.
    Don't use music purchased from the iTunes Music Store. They are protected and can't be exported to QuickTime formats.

  • Making Quicktime slide shows (videos) with Windows

    Hello. With the Mac platform, I am able to use my photo program, iPhoto, export photos from it and make a Quicktime slide show (video, with accompanying music from my music program, iTunes. Is this also possible with Windows, ie: where would the 'Export' command be and how would music be integrated into it? Any other helpful comments would be appreciated. Thank you.

    You can open many different audio and image formats with the Windows version of QuickTime Pro. To assemble a slide show of still images you could open a folder of liked sized, sequentially named images and add that new file "scaled" to the audio track.
    You could also open the audio track and "add scaled to selection" your individual image files. This method would allow you set the duration of each slide to different values but would limit your show to 98 images (99 track limit).
    This method could also use different image dimensions, different "offsets", transparency "blends" and mask layers. Depending on your intended distribution format you could make HD sized QuickTime movies with multiple images displaying simultaneously (Brady Bunch style).

  • Slide Show Movies?

    Forgive such a simple question, can you do slide show movies in Final Cut?
    My niece is a photographer who would like to present her clients with a slide show movie complete with an original soundtrack. iMovie & iPhoto just don't cut it.
    I know it seems ridiculous to look at final cut for slide show movies, just nothing else has yielded the results.
    Can one work with .jpeg in Final Cut? I saw no mention of it on the Apple site. Please enlighten me.
    We are looking to produce professional quality DVD's. of photo shoots with the ability to edit photos & music simultaneously in the timeline.
    TY

    Sure you can. I have a client who hires me a couple of times a year to do one for her.
    Yes you can use JPEG. Some things to remember. Know your settings. A 4x3 screen size will translate into a 720x480pixels graphic at 72 dpi. Now, most digital photos are larger than that and Final Cut will translate those to screen size when you import. However, if you are scanning snapshots that's a handy thing to keep in mind.
    Animated backgrounds work great under photos that are vertical. Otherwise they will appear over black which is okay but boring.
    If you produce/scan your photos and save as a photoshop file you will be able to manipulate individual layers.
    To save time, I lay my music on the time line then I highlight all of the photos I want and drag and drop then using "overwrite-with-transition." This will give you a dissolve between each photo. You can change duration of the photos from there to match to you song. Of course if you don't want dissolves just edit them one all at once or one at a time.
